Skip to content

Commit b2d7496

Browse files
authored
Merge pull request #6 from Equipe-Meta-Code/refactor/api-centralize-baseURL
refactor: centralize baseURL in api2 service
2 parents 8f4920c + 1e7f86a commit b2d7496

3 files changed

Lines changed: 5 additions & 5 deletions

File tree

app/src/pages/Cadastro/Cadastro.tsx

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 import { Text, View, Image, Alert, TextInput, TouchableOpacity, TouchableWithout
44
import { MaterialIcons } from '@expo/vector-icons';
55
import { useNavigation, NavigationProp } from '@react-navigation/native';
66

7-
import axios from "axios";
7+
import api2 from "../../services/api2";
88

99
export default function Cadastro() {
1010
const navigation = useNavigation<NavigationProp<any>>();
@@ -47,7 +47,7 @@ export default function Cadastro() {
4747
return Alert.alert('Erro', 'Você precisa aceitar os termos e condições para se cadastrar!');
4848
}
4949

50-
const response = await axios.post('http://<ip-da-sua-maquina>:3333/register', {
50+
const response = await api2.post('/register', {
5151
name,
5252
email,
5353
password

app/src/pages/login/Login.tsx

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 import { useNavigation, NavigationProp } from '@react-navigation/native';
66

77
import { useDispatch, useSelector } from "react-redux";
88
import { loginUserAction } from "../../(redux)/authSlice";
9-
import axios from "axios";
9+
import api2 from "../../services/api2";
1010

1111
export default function Login() {
1212
const navigation = useNavigation<NavigationProp<any>>();
@@ -36,7 +36,7 @@ export default function Login() {
3636

3737
setLoading(true);
3838

39-
const response = await axios.post('http://<ip-da-sua-maquina>:3333/login', {
39+
const response = await api2.post('/login', {
4040
email,
4141
password
4242
});

app/src/services/api2.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
import axios from "axios";
22

33
const api2 = axios.create({
4-
baseURL: 'http://192.168.1.18:3333/'
4+
baseURL: 'http://<ip-da-sua-maquina>:3333/'
55
});
66

77
export default api2;

0 commit comments

Comments
 (0)